Regular Season Round 12: Ehingen - Kirchheim 68-66
Date: December 2, 2012
A very close game took place in Allmendingen between Ehingen/Urspringschule and Kirchheim Knights. Ninth ranked Ehingen/Urspringschule (6-6) got a very close home victory over 12th ranked Kirchheim Knights (4-8). Ehingen/Urspringschule managed to escape with a 2-point win 68-66 on Sunday evening. The hosts trailed by 9 points after three quarters before their 23-12 charge, which allowed them to win the game. Ehingen/Urspringschule forced 19 Kirchheim Knights turnovers. Strangely Kirchheim Knights outrebounded Ehingen/Urspringschule 41-24 including 16 on the offensive glass. Worth to mention a great performance of American guard Virgil Matthews (188-83, college: Montana) who helped to win the game recording 12 points, 8 rebounds and 5 assists and the other American import forward Andre Calvin (196-85, college: Drake) who added 11 points and 6 rebounds during the contest. Four Ehingen/Urspringschule players scored in double figures. The best for the losing side was American point guard Chris Alexander (186-83, college: Southern) with 20 points and power forward Jonathan Maier (210-92, agency: Limelight Hoops) scored 7 points and 12 rebounds. Kirchheim Knights' coach rotated ten players in this game, but that didn't help. Ehingen/Urspringschule moved-up to eighth place, which they share with Finke Baskets and Chemnitz. Loser Kirchheim Knights keep the twelfth position with eight games lost. They share it with ETB Wohnbau and Crailsheim. Ehingen/Urspringschule will meet higher ranked Science City Jena (#6) on the road in the next round and it may be quite challenging game. Kirchheim Knights will play against Duesseldorf Baskets (#3) and hope to secure a win.
Top scorers:
Ehingen: V.Matthews 12+8reb+5ast, M.Mueller 11+2ast, T.Unterluggauer 11+2reb, A.Calvin 11+6reb+3ast, S.Marlon Theis 7+1reb+1ast, K.Ogbe 6+2reb+2ast
Kirchheim: C.Alexander 20+4reb+1ast, C.Brooks 12+5reb+1ast, C.Land 8+5reb+1ast, J.Maier 7+12reb+3ast, T.Burnette 6, D.Schneider 5+5reb
